Latest Patents

Yamada's recent innovations include two notable patents. The first is an **Electric-Power Conversion Apparatus**, which features a heat sink designed with unequal side portions that optimize the positioning of reactors and capacitors for enhanced efficiency. This novel design ensures effective heat management and functionality within electric power systems.

His second recent patent is an **Electric-Power Conversion System Controller**. This invention addresses the challenges faced when temperatures of switching devices and diodes rise. By implementing a voltage-boosting control mechanism, Yamada's controller maintains device performance and longevity, thereby mitigating the adverse effects of heat in operating conditions.
